Fundamental Analysis: The Backbone of Long-Term Investing
Fundamental analysis is all about understanding a company’s true value. It involves studying the business model, revenue, profits, assets, liabilities, and economic factors affecting the business. In simpler words, it’s about asking, “Is this company worth investing in for the long term?”
Key aspects of fundamental analysis include:
-
Earnings per Share (EPS): This shows how much profit the company makes per share. Higher EPS is usually better.
-
Price-to-Earnings Ratio (P/E): This compares the current share price to earnings per share. A lower P/E often means a stock is undervalued.
-
Return on Equity (ROE): Shows how efficiently the company is using shareholders’ funds to generate profits.
-
Debt-to-Equity Ratio: Helps assess the company’s debt levels. Lower is usually better.
-
Future Growth Potential: Analysts look at the sector, upcoming projects, and leadership vision.
Fundamental analysis is ideal for long-term investing in blue-chip stocks or value investing in India. It helps you understand whether a stock is trading below or above its fair value. This analysis is especially valuable for those who want to build a strong financial portfolio in India.
Technical Analysis: Timing the Market
While fundamental analysis tells you what to buy, technical analysis helps you decide when to buy or sell. It is based on reading stock charts and predicting price movements through patterns, indicators, and volumes.
Popular technical tools include:
-
Candlestick Patterns: Like Doji, Hammer, Shooting Star – help understand market sentiment.
-
Moving Averages (MA): 50-day and 200-day MAs help identify trends.
-
Relative Strength Index (RSI): Tells if a stock is overbought or oversold.
-
MACD (Moving Average Convergence Divergence): Indicates bullish or bearish momentum.
-
Volume Analysis: High volume confirms the strength of price movement.
Technical analysis is ideal for short-term trading, swing trading, and intraday trading strategies in India. It helps you avoid emotional decisions and trade with confidence.

Intraday/Day Trading: High Risk, High Reward
Intraday trading involves buying and selling stocks on the same day. The goal is to make profits from small price movements within the market hours. While this can be profitable, it also comes with higher risk.
Key tips for intraday trading:
-
Choose Liquid Stocks: High trading volume means easy entry and exit.
-
Use Stop Loss: Always set a limit to cut your losses early.
-
Follow the Trend: “Trend is your friend” – trade in the direction of the market.
-
Have a Plan: Decide your entry, target, and exit before you place a trade.
-
Avoid Overtrading: Too many trades increase chances of mistakes.
Day trading requires a solid understanding of technical indicators, market psychology, and risk management. Most importantly, you must practice with discipline. Good training and simulated practice sessions help sharpen these skills.

1. Intraday Trading (Day Trading)
Intraday trading in India means buying and selling stocks on the same day. Traders aim to make profits from small price movements during market hours.
Key Features:
-
Positions are squared off before the market closes.
-
Traders use technical indicators like candlestick charts, RSI, and volume analysis.
-
High risk, but also high reward potential.
-
Requires a demat and trading account with fast execution.

2. Swing Trading
Swing trading in India focuses on capturing gains in a stock within a few days to a few weeks. It’s less stressful than intraday but still offers active trading opportunities.
Why It’s Popular:
-
Balances risk and time commitment.
-
Works well for people with full-time jobs.
-
Uses technical analysis and trend-following strategies.
-
Less brokerage compared to daily trading.

3. Positional Trading
Positional trading in India involves holding stocks for several weeks or even months. This strategy suits people who want to grow wealth steadily over time.
Highlights:
-
Based on both technical and fundamental analysis.
-
Less monitoring required than daily trading.
-
Focus on strong companies with long-term growth potential.

4. Scalping (Ultra Short-Term Trading)
Scalping in Indian stock market is an advanced technique where traders take multiple small profits throughout the day.
Key Points:
-
Trades last from a few seconds to a few minutes.
-
Requires a high-speed trading platform and low brokerage charges.
-
Best suited for experts with fast decision-making skills.

6. Options and Futures Trading (Derivatives)
Derivatives trading in India involves contracts that derive value from underlying assets like stocks, indexes, or commodities.
Types:
-
Options trading: Buy or sell rights without obligation.
-
Futures trading: Agree to buy/sell at a fixed future price.
-
Common in Nifty, Bank Nifty, and large-cap stocks.
